Product Structure (CATIA Assembly)

The hierarchical tree of components, sub-assemblies, and instances in a CATIA assembly (.CATProduct).

Definition

A Product is a CATIA assembly container. It references CATParts and other CATProducts. Each reference is an instance with a position, an instance name, and possibly publications exposed to the assembly. Multi-instance support means one CATPart referenced multiple times in the Product.

Why it matters

Product structure determines BOM, assembly performance, and access control. A flat Product with 50k CATPart references is unmanageable; a deeply nested structure that matches the real manufacturing tree is.

Common pitfalls

  • All parts at one level — performance and clarity suffer.
  • Instances vs. references confused — editing an instance affects all instances of that CATPart.
  • Mismatched display modes (visualization vs. design) — visual artefacts in large assemblies.

What's the difference between CATIA and SOLIDWORKS, both Dassault products?

Different markets. SOLIDWORKS is mid-market mechanical CAD (industrial machinery, consumer products). CATIA is high-end (aerospace, automotive, very large assemblies, class-A surfacing). CATIA's learning curve, price, and capability are substantially higher.

Is CATIA available for individual hobbyists?

No. CATIA is sold through VARs to enterprises and educational institutions. Hobbyists looking for similar capability use Rhino (surfacing), Plasticity (modern direct modelling), Onshape (cloud), or older perpetual versions of SOLIDWORKS via student licenses.

What is the difference between V5 and V6?

V5 is the file-based desktop platform (still widely used). V6 was the predecessor to 3DEXPERIENCE — server-stored on ENOVIA V6. CATIA on 3DEXPERIENCE is the current 'V6'-equivalent track. Many organisations run both V5 and 3DX in parallel.
